There are various locations across Blackburn with Darwen where you can take your household refuse and recyclables.
There are 2 recycling centres:
Blackburn
George Street West
BB2 1PQ
(01254) 698025
Darwen
Spring Vale Road
BB3 2ES
(01254) 760414
Please separate out your rubbish for recycling before you visit the site - this saves money on burying recyclable items and helps protect our environment.
Thank You! - with your help we are recycling about 70% of everything which is taken to these sites.
The sites are open everyday (except Christmas Day, Boxing Day and New Years Day)
8am - 5pm 1 October - 31 March
8am - 7pm 1 April - 30 September
If you use a van to move rubbish, you will need a permit to enter the HWRC.
